One of the ways you'll be connected to your classmates and to your instructor
is via discussion conferences. Discussion conferences
let you post [1] and read [2] messages,
without having to be online at the same time as anyone else.
The conferences
are arranged according to topics or purposes. You might have a conference
devoted to discussing a particular question for the week. Or you might
have a conference for a small group working together on a project. There's
also a Coffee Shop conference, where you can "meet"
everyone enrolled in a Master's course during the semester, and a Prayer
and Praise conference, where you can share and encourage each other.
Sometimes
your instructor may ask you to submit an assignment to a discussion conference,
so that everyone in the class can benefit from each other's work.
